The Netherlands cricket team played its first T20I match on 2 August 2008, against Kenya as part of the 2008 ICC World Twenty20 Qualifier, winning the match by 19 runs. [ 2 ] This list comprises all members of the Netherlands cricket team who have played at least one T20I match.
The 2024 Netherlands Tri-Nation Series was a cricket tournament that took place in the Netherlands in May 2024. [1] It was a tri-nation series involving Netherlands , Ireland and Scotland men's cricket teams, with the matches played as Twenty20 International (T20I) fixtures. [ 2 ]
The Netherlands enjoyed full One Day International status from 1 January 2006 until 1 February 2014. [8] They regained Twenty20 International status in June 2014, having played their first match in this format in 2008. [9] The Netherlands regained their ODI status after the conclusion of the 2018 Cricket World Cup Qualifier in March 2018.

The 2024 Nepal Tri-Nation Series was the first round of the 2024–2026 ICC Cricket World Cup League 2 cricket tournament took place in Nepal in February 2024. [1] The tri-nation series was contested by the men's national teams of Namibia, Nepal and Netherlands. [2] The matches were played as One Day International (ODI) fixtures. [3] [4]
